Output e253ba3aa61bf276b01f9d2cb92c112d7a2991de32bdb8d8d85943d2aedeaa5d:1

value
25325762
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98c5ba53dbdb757f838398b968a591b3edfb5e0e OP_EQUALVERIFY OP_CHECKSIG
address
1EvnaXiNvWG5CMWimKGLompntqQxpZyQV8
transaction
e253ba3aa61bf276b01f9d2cb92c112d7a2991de32bdb8d8d85943d2aedeaa5d
confirmations
451622
spent
true